CloudLaya is a Kathmandu-based multi-cloud service provider founded in 2017. The company helps businesses adopt, manage, and optimize cloud infrastructure across platforms like AWS, Microsoft Azure, Google Cloud, Huawei Cloud, Alibaba Cloud, and DigitalOcean. With a team of experienced cloud engineers and consultants, CloudLaya delivers end-to-end solutions including cloud consulting, architecture design, migration, and managed services.

Their offerings cover cloud infrastructure management, DevOps as a Service, data analytics, disaster recovery, and backup solutions. Additionally, they provide web hosting, email hosting, and office productivity tools like Google Workspace, Microsoft 365, and Zoho Mail.

CloudLaya is an AWS-certified partner and collaborates with major tech providers like Google Cloud, Azure, Zoho, Pax8, and Connex. Trusted by over 250 clients, including companies like Yeti Airlines, NET TV, and MeroJob, they focus on reliability, cost-efficiency, and scalability.

With a strong mission to simplify cloud adoption, CloudLaya empowers businesses to accelerate digital transformation, reduce operational costs, and improve performance. Their recent innovation, CostQ.ai, is an AI-driven tool designed to help businesses optimize AWS costs by up to 40%. CloudLaya remains committed to supporting the tech ecosystem through community events and partnerships.

CodeTasty features and specs

  • Cloud-Based
    CodeTasty is cloud-based, allowing you to access your projects from anywhere with an internet connection, which promotes flexibility and remote collaboration.
  • Collaborative Features
    CodeTasty offers real-time collaboration features enabling multiple users to work on the same project simultaneously, which is beneficial for team projects.
  • Wide Language Support
    The platform supports multiple programming languages, making it versatile for developers working with diverse coding needs.
  • Easy Setup
    There's no need to install software locally, which simplifies the setup process and saves time for developers.
  • In-Browser Coding
    Allows users to code directly in the browser without the need for local machine resources, enhancing accessibility and convenience.

Possible disadvantages of CodeTasty

  • Limited Offline Access
    As a cloud-based IDE, it requires an internet connection to function, which can be a limitation in environments with unreliable connectivity.
  • Performance Constraints
    Depending on internet speed and browser capability, the performance may not be as high as traditional locally installed IDEs, potentially affecting efficiency.
  • Subscription Costs
    While offering a free tier, advanced features may be behind a paywall, which can be a barrier for some users or small teams with limited budgets.
  • Security Concerns
    Storing and editing code in the cloud increases the risk of potential data breaches, making security a critical consideration.
  • Dependency on Browser
    Functionality and experience might vary depending on the browser used, leading to inconsistent user experiences.
